展开

关键词

近期问题: jq循环中异步请求问题

问题1: 今天开发遇到了一个问题, 页面中的列表是通过循环ajax进行请求的,最后需要对请求结束的数据进行判断和统计,所以就存在异步问题,当然不用ES6, 一开始想的是用 async:false, 使用后发现 Array.prototype.fill不兼容IE function createIpList(obj) { $('#ip-table-tbody').html('')

28720

jq tmpl输出编码html,jQuery tmpl 讲解「建议收藏」

一个轻量级的前端模板引擎(vue.js也是一种前端模板引擎) (3)可以在模板中实现逻辑运算 2、jQuery-tmpl的语法 (1)占位:${变量}或{ {= 变量}} 注:=和变量之间一定要有空格 (2)循环 出生日期必须为8位数(如:20160808) 国籍: {nationality} 性别: 男女 var temp = $(“#PsgerTemp”).html (); var html=temp.replace(“{nationality}”,nationalityHtml).replace(“{ptype}”, 1).replace(“{type}”, “成人 ”).replace(“{isShowMobile}”,””).replace(/\{i\}/g, i); 通常来说,都会有很多个人,如果使用模板的话,只要写一遍html代码,剩余的就是遍历人数,拼接html 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/149521.html原文链接:https://javaforall.cn

7820
  • 广告
    关闭

    【玩转 Cloud Studio】有奖调研征文,千元豪礼等你拿!

    想听听你玩转的独门秘籍,更有机械键盘、鹅厂公仔、CODING 定制公仔等你来拿!

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    循环输出 HTML 标题【JavaScript 循环应用学习】

    循环输出 HTML 标题【JavaScript 循环应用学习】 image.png 实战代码如下 <! D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>菜鸟教程</title> </head> <body>

    本例调用的函数会执行一个计算 { return a*b; } document.getElementById("demo").innerHTML=myFunction(4,3); </script> </body> </html

    29200

    jq和zepto

    目录 类库和框架的区别 写法 jq操作样式 属性 事件 class dom操作 效果 类库和框架的区别 jq jq是一个功能丰富,轻量级的类库 zepto.js zepto.js 是更轻量级的类库 ,比jq的打开速度快的多,同样兼容jq的代码 apicloud apicloud是一个框架 类库 提供了很多api,相当于一个仓库,里面有各种各样的工具,你需要用到什么就去找这些工具。 框架 相当于买了一个新房子,现在是一个空壳,需要去装修 写法 $(selector).action(); selector: 选择器名称 action: jq对象的一个方法 jq操作样式 "); 操作一个样式 $('.kk').css("样式名称","样式值"); 操作多个样式 $('#wrap').css({"样式名称1":"样式值1","样式名称2":"样式值2"}); 属性 获取html 内容 $('#test').html() 修改html内容 $('#test').html('

    段落

    ') 获取不带标签的文本内容 $('#test').text() 修改文本内容 $('#test

    41310

    jq使用建议

    前言 我们在一些陈旧或者传统mvc的项目中还是会经常使用jq,但是由于对jq api或者核心思想不熟悉,导致我们的某些写法并不是特别好,这里会摘录一些一些并给出大家更好的写法建议。 循环筛选目标元素耗时 如果你有需要判定某列表中的元素是否具有某特点,尽量用选择器去实现,不要用循环 //不建议 $("li").each(function(index){ if($(this). 原理也很简单,在任何一个jq方法结束其操作之后都会重新返回其jq对象。我们找到源码部分:jq的show(),hide()方法,可以看到其最后会把原生对象重新返回。 return showHide( this ); } } 基于链式思想的写法建议 同一操作对象的多个方法并列 //不建议 $(target).addClass('class1') $(target).html ('文本内容') //建议,不超过四个操作写在同一行,超过四个可以考虑每四个换行 $(target).addClass('class1').html('文本内容') 相关元素的操作,经典场景:过滤tab

    22310

    jq-tab

    doctype html> <html lang< class="value">"UTF-8"> <title>jq </body> </html

    11630

    jq案例代码

    D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title> <style type= href="javascript:void(0);">二级菜单3

    </body> </html D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title> <style type=
  • </body> </html

    9520

    jq获取实时宽度

    6420

    jq 控制显示隐藏div

    之前一直使用attr("style","display:none;")来隐藏div

    46930

    riot.js教程【六】循环HTML元素标签

    前文回顾 riot.js教程【五】标签嵌套、命名元素、事件、标签条件 riot.js教程【四】Mixins、HTML内嵌表达式 riot.js教程【三】访问DOM元素、使用jquery、mount }

    this.arr = [ true, 110, Math.random(), 'fourth'] </my-tag> 对象属性循环 与简单数组循环相对,下面的代码是对象属性循环 <my-tag ,不推荐使用; riotjs是通过JSON.stringify来判断对象是否有变更,以此来决定是否要更新HTML元素 key属性 你可以在循环标签的时候,使用key属性 <loop>

    jq---方法总结

    就像官方所宣称的那样——"Write less,do more",它使得我们常用的HTML文档遍历、DOM操作、事件处理、动画效果、Ajax、工具方法等功能代码的实现变得非常简单。 $(":selected"); // 选取所有选中的option元素 $(":input"); // 选取所有的表单控件元素(所有input、textarea、select、button元素) 五:将HTML // 返回匹配这些ul元素中的所有子代元素的jQuery对象 $("selector").val("Hello"); // 设置所有匹配元素的value值为"Hello" $("selector").html

    29720

    AJAX(JQ应用、layer)

    layer开发文档学习网站:http://www.layui.com/doc/modules/layer.html (原文写于2017.8.14)

    31930

    JQ事件和事件对象

    无论移入哪个元素都会加1 }) $('.div1').mouseenter(function(){ $('#num2').html block') } //滚动条的距离scrollTop()和scrollLeft() })  2 事件对象   JQ div id="div1">

    <script> $(document).mousemove(function(e){ $('#div1').html clientY:"+e.clientY+"
    "+"screenY:"+e.screenY) }) </script> </body> </html

    54020

    jq 与cookie的结合

    定义:让网站服务器把少量数据储存到客户端的硬盘或内存,从客户端的硬盘读取数据的一种技术;

    7510

    JQ 选择器大全

    $(".one+div") <==> $(".one").next("div");

    37320

    Centos7安装jq

    安装epel-release源 yum install epel-release yum -y install jq 使用 curl https://openapi.esign.cn |jq .

    36640

    JQ实现倒计时功能

    使用JQ实现发送短信或阅读倒计时效果,结合bootstrap框架。直接上效果图: ? 代码: <! DOCTYPE html> <html lang="zh-cn"> <head>     <meta charset="UTF-8">     <meta http-equiv="X-UA-Compatible             //更改描述性文字  status = false;  var timer = setInterval(() => {                 time--;  $(this).<em>html</em> (time + ' 秒后再次发送');  if (time === 0) {                     clearInterval(timer);  $(this).<em>html</em>("点击发送验证码 attr('disabled', false);  status = true;  }             }, 1000)         }     }); </script> </body> </html

    34400

    使用jq处理JSON数据(二)

    之前的文章使用jq处理JSON数据(一)中,我分享了jq工具的基本用法。今天开始分享jq的高阶使用,包括管道符、函数以及格式转换。 管道符和函数 在这个章节中中,将分享jq更多过滤JSON数据的方法。 使用|运算符,我们可以结合两个过滤器。它的工作原理与Unix系统管道符类似。左边的过滤器的输出传递到右边的过滤器。 例如,我们可以使用keys函数来获取JSON数据某个节点的键集合: ✘ fv@FunTester  ~/Downloads  cat FunTester.json | jq '. | keys' 转换格式 这个章节,我将分享一些使用jq将原来JSON数据组合转换其他格式的技巧。 请注意,jq表达式中,要想构建新的JSON格式数据,如果key为表达式时,需要用()括起来,但是value是表达式的时候就不用了,仅限于单表达式,下面会介绍一些复合表达式不适用。

    54430

    jq获取滚动条距离

    最近开学了,也在写新的项目,很多实例都用到了滚动条的距离,判断距离显示指定的内容(主要用于顶部导航的固定)

    51620

    jq ---- 实现浏览器全屏

    出现的bug:所有的元素会居中,不在html 的左上角。 解决的方法:给html 设置一个相对定位,给body 一个决定定位。 ?

    51240

    相关产品

    • 文档服务

      文档服务

      文档服务(DS)由腾讯云数据万象提供,支持多种类型的文件生成图片或 html 格式的预览,可以解决文档内容的页面展示问题,满足多端的文档在线浏览需求。同时,还提供文本隐私筛查能力,可以有效识别文本中的身份证号、手机号等敏感数据,满足数据可用性和隐私保护的各种要求。

    相关资讯

    热门标签

    活动推荐

    扫码关注腾讯云开发者

    领取腾讯云代金券